This report provides information on the prevalence of selected lifetime and twelve-month mental disorders by three major disorder groups: anxiety disorders (eg social phobia), affective disorders (eg depression) and substance use disorders (eg alcohol harmful use). It also provides information on the level of impairment, the health services used for mental health problems, physical conditions, social networks and caregiving, as well as demographic and socio-economic characteristics. The survey collected information from approximately 8,800 Australians aged 16-85 years.
